Find tickets for The Christmas Show in Staten Island, NY at St. George Theatre on Dec 14, 2024. St. George Theatre is located in Staten Island, NY
Find tickets for The Christmas Show in Staten Island, NY at St. George Theatre on Dec 14, 2024. St. George Theatre is located in Staten Island, NY